Breaking Free: Understanding Addiction and Recovery

Addiction, a difficult issue, can trap individuals in a cycle of reliance that feels impossible to break free from. It's often characterized by compulsive behaviors despite detrimental consequences. Understanding the basis of addiction – which can stem from a combination of inherent predispositions, environmental factors, and emotional distress – is essential for both those struggling and their family. Recovery is a process, not a final point, and often involves professional help, support groups, and a profound commitment to transformation. Explore some aspects of the journey:

  • Recognizing the triggering factors.
  • Establishing coping strategies.
  • Seeking counseling support.
  • Fostering a caring network.
  • Maintaining a commitment to recovery.
